|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Behavioral Intervention Specialist | Work directly with children to develop and implement behavior modification plans, ensuring positive outcomes in educational settings. |
| Special Education Teacher | Provide tailored instruction and support to students with behavioral challenges, ensuring they meet academic and social goals. |
| School Counselor | Offer emotional and behavioral support to students, helping them navigate challenges and develop coping strategies. |
| Child Psychologist | Assess and address behavioral issues through therapeutic interventions, collaborating with educators and families. |
| Behavioral Consultant | Advise schools and educators on effective strategies to manage and support children with behavioral challenges. |
| Inclusion Coordinator | Promote inclusive education by ensuring children with behavioral issues receive equitable access to learning opportunities. |
| Educational Therapist | Provide one-on-one support to students, addressing both academic and behavioral needs through specialized interventions. |
